Margaret McDuffie Plays Jazz Old & New at The Jay Heritage Center

We’re very excited to be performing on March 1st at the Jay Heritage Center in Rye, NY. This historic site hosts numerous events centered on history, education and nature, for both adults and children. Originally the residence of John Jay, the property has been beautifully restored over many years, and while the work continues, The Jay Center provides an amazing variety of talks, walks and music to the area at large. With a view on the sound, it is an uplifting place to spend a few hours and connect with both the history and people you encounter there.

Jazz old and new is the theme for the evening of March 1st. Margaret will begin with a collection of jazz standards from the American songbook and ballads of her own in the classic standard style. In the second set, the group unfolds a sample spectrum exploring her original contemporary music, with influences from jazzy blues to country swing. Margaret’s skillful and hypnotic singing is supported by the wonderful talents of Steve Raleigh on guitar, T. Xiques on drums, Michael Goetz on bass, and Grammy winner Art Labriola on keys.
